Description
Step back in time with a modern twist! The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ass is a compact yet mighty bass combo amplifier that pays homage to the iconic rigs of the British Invasion era. Fitted with Vox's innovative NuTube technology, this 50-watt mini stack delivers genuine tube-like warmth and punchy tones, perfect for any bassist looking to capture that classic Vox sound. Its analog preamp circuit is bolstered by a built-in compressor to beef up your tone and a fuzz circuit for when you want to add some grit and sustain.
The Mini Superbeetle's design is both functional and nostalgic, featuring a closed-back cabinet with a custom 8" speaker, all perched on Vox's distinctive chrome stand. Whether you’re practicing, recording, or performing, this amp has got you covered with its versatile headphone/line output and speaker output for connecting to a variety of extension cabinets.

FAQs
-
What is the power output of the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p?
-
The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p delivers a power output of 50 watts, making it suitable for small venues and practice sessions.
-
Does the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p have onboard effects?
-
Yes, the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p features onboard compressor and fuzz effects, allowing for versatile tonal shaping.
-
Is the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p suitable for live performances?
-
With its 50-watt output, the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p is ideal for small gigs and practice, but may not be powerful enough for larger venues without additional amplification.
-
What type of speaker configuration does the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ass use?
-
The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ass utilizes a 1x8" speaker configuration, designed to deliver clear and rich low-end tones.
-
Does the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p have a tube sound?
-
Yes, the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ass amp uses Nutube technology to provide an analog vacuum tube sound while maintaining a compact size.

Owner Insights
We analyzed real musician discussions from forums and Reddit to find what players love, question, and tweak about Vox Mini Superbeetle Bass.
Features and functionality
-
The amp includes a headphone jack for silent practice and may have a Bluetooth model for playing along with media tracks.
Source -
Reverb is considered decent, but the tremolo effect lacks depth control, making it less effective.
Source -
The Bluetooth version does not include a tremolo feature, unlike the original MSB with Nutube.
Source -
The amp mimics tube sound with a Nutube technology, but users note it breaks up quickly with the gain knob, imitating real tube overdrive.
Source -
Lacks mid control in the EQ, which affects tonal shaping capabilities.
Source
Comparisons
-
Compared to the Pathfinder 15r, the Mini Superbeetle offers a more versatile sound at both low and high volumes.
Source -
The Vox Mini Superbeetle Audio Bluetooth version is notably different from the MSB 50 amp, lacking the Nutube technology and having a different speaker arrangement.
Source -
Described as similar to a Vox AC4 but less warm, providing a distinct tonal comparison.
Source
Use cases and applications
-
Works well for home use or gigs in bars when mic'd, but struggles with loud drummers unless connected to larger speaker cabs.
Source -
The Bluetooth version is favored for aesthetic appeal and versatility, suitable for streaming music in living spaces or as a decorative piece.
Source -
Considered a fun amp for home practice, especially for experimenting with different sounds.
Source
User experience
-
Owners note the amp captures classic Vox tones and performs well with pedals for home practice.
Source
Value and pricing
-
Despite its stylish appearance, some owners feel the Bluetooth version is expensive for its performance, suggesting comparable sound to more affordable waterproof Bluetooth speakers.
